Bitcoin ETF SEC Decision: The Implications and Future Prospects

The United States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has been reviewing the application for a Bitcoin exchange-traded fund (ETF) since 2018. The SEC has been cautious in approving Bitcoin ETFs due to concerns about the volatility of the cryptocurrency market and the lack of regulatory clarity. However, a positive ruling from the SEC would have significant implications for the Bitcoin and cryptocurrency industries, as well as investors.

Background

A Bitcoin ETF would allow investors to purchase a stake in the entire Bitcoin market, rather than just the individual coins. This would make it easier for institutional investors to invest in Bitcoin, as they would not need to purchase the underlying asset directly. This could lead to increased liquidity and stability in the Bitcoin market, as well as more widespread adoption of the currency.

The SEC's Review Process

The SEC has been reviewing nine applications for Bitcoin ETFs, including the popular VanEck/SolidX Bitcoin Trust. The commission has been concerned about the volatility of the Bitcoin market, as well as the lack of regulatory clarity in the cryptocurrency space. As a result, the SEC has been cautious in its approval of Bitcoin ETFs, waiting for sufficient regulatory frameworks to be in place before allowing a product to launch.

The Potential Impact of a Positive Ruling

If the SEC were to approve a Bitcoin ETF, it would have a significant impact on the cryptocurrency industry and the broader financial market. Some of the potential benefits include:

1. Increased institutional investment: A Bitcoin ETF would make it easier for institutional investors to participate in the Bitcoin market, which could lead to increased liquidity and stability in the cryptocurrency market.

2. Regulatory clarity: A positive ruling from the SEC would provide much-needed regulatory clarity for the cryptocurrency industry, which could help attract more investors and developers.

3. Positive sentiment: A successful Bitcoin ETF launch could have a positive impact on the overall sentiment towards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ies, as it would demonstrate that the SEC believes the market is mature and ready for such a product.

4. Enhanced transparency: A Bitcoin ETF would provide investors with a transparent, regulated investment vehicle, which could help to improve trust and adoption of the cryptocurrency.

5. Potential for further regulation: A positive ruling from the SEC could lead to further regulation and oversight of the cryptocurrency industry, which could help to provide additional stability and protection for investors.

The decision by the SEC on the VanEck/SolidX Bitcoin Trust application will have significant implications for the Bitcoin and cryptocurrency industries, as well as investors. A positive ruling from the SEC could lead to increased institutional investment, regulatory clarity, and a positive sentiment towards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ies. However, investors should also consider the potential risks and volatility associated with the cryptocurrency market.
